    Services Offered at First Medical Mayaguez

    Alright, let's get into the nitty-gritty of what services First Medical Mayaguez actually offers. This hospital isn't just a one-trick pony; they've got a whole range of specialties and services to cater to different needs. One of their core offerings is emergency care. They have a 24/7 emergency department staffed with experienced doctors and nurses ready to handle anything from minor injuries to life-threatening situations. They’re equipped to deal with trauma, cardiac events, and other urgent medical needs. Another significant area is cardiology. First Medical Mayaguez has a dedicated cardiology department that provides diagnostic testing, treatment, and rehabilitation for heart-related conditions. Whether you need an EKG, echocardiogram, or more complex procedures like angioplasty, they've got the expertise and technology. For those dealing with cancer, the oncology department offers comprehensive cancer care. This includes chemotherapy, radiation therapy, surgery, and supportive care services. They focus on creating individualized treatment plans tailored to each patient's specific needs. Orthopedics is another vital service. If you've got joint pain, a sports injury, or need a joint replacement, the orthopedic team can help. They offer a range of surgical and non-surgical treatments to restore mobility and relieve pain. Pediatrics is also a significant part of what they do. The hospital has a dedicated pediatric unit that provides medical care for infants, children, and adolescents. From routine check-ups to treating childhood illnesses, the pediatricians are skilled in caring for young patients. In addition to these specialties, First Medical Mayaguez offers a range of diagnostic services. This includes radiology (X-rays, CT scans, MRIs), laboratory services, and other tests to help diagnose medical conditions accurately. They also provide surgical services, covering everything from general surgery to specialized procedures. The surgeons are experienced and use advanced techniques to ensure the best possible outcomes. Rehabilitation services are also available, including phys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y. These services help patients recover from injuries, surgeries, or illnesses and regain their independence. Furthermore, First Medical Mayaguez offers women's health services, including obstetrics and gynecology. They provide prenatal care, childbirth services, and treatment for gynecological conditions. Mental health services are also available, with psychiatrists and therapists offering counseling and treatment for mental health issues. Finally, the hospital provides preventative care services, such as vaccinations, health screenings, and wellness programs. These services are designed to help you stay healthy and prevent future medical problems.     What to Expect During Your Visit

    So, you're heading to First Medical Mayaguez? Knowing what to expect can ease some of that pre-visit anxiety. Let’s break down what a typical visit might look like. First off, if you're going for a scheduled appointment, try to arrive a bit early. This gives you time to find parking, check in, and fill out any necessary paperwork without feeling rushed. Parking can sometimes be a bit tricky, so factor that into your arrival time. When you get to the reception area, you'll need to check in. Have your insurance card, ID, and any referral documents ready. The receptionist will verify your information and give you any forms you need to complete. Be honest and thorough when filling out these forms. Accurate information is crucial for providing the best possible care. After checking in, you'll likely be asked to wait in the waiting area. The length of your wait can vary depending on how busy the clinic is and the nature of your appointment. Bring a book or something to keep you occupied. Once it's your turn, a nurse or medical assistant will call your name and take you to an examination room. They'll check your vital signs (like blood pressure and temperature) and ask about your medical history and current symptoms. This is your chance to share any concerns or questions you have. The doctor will then come in to examine you. They'll review your medical history, ask more detailed questions, and perform a physical examination. Be prepared to answer questions about your symptoms, medications, and any other relevant information. The doctor may order additional tests, such as blood work, X-rays, or other imaging studies. These tests help them get a clearer picture of your condition. If tests are needed, the staff will explain the process and where to go. After the examination and any necessary tests, the doctor will discuss their findings with you. They'll explain your diagnosis, treatment options, and any follow-up care you need. Don't hesitate to ask questions if anything is unclear. It's important to understand your condition and treatment plan. If you need medications, the doctor will write a prescription. You can usually fill the prescription at a pharmacy within the hospital or at a nearby pharmacy. Before you leave, make sure you understand all the instructions for your treatment plan. This includes medication dosages, follow-up appointments, and any lifestyle changes you need to make. If you have any questions or concerns after you leave, don't hesitate to call the hospital or clinic. They're there to support you throughout your healthcare journey. For emergency visits, the process is a bit different. You'll be triaged upon arrival to determine the severity of your condition. Patients with the most urgent needs are seen first. Be prepared for a potentially longer wait if your condition is not life-threatening.     Tips for a Smooth Hospital Experience

    Okay, let's talk about making your visit to First Medical Mayaguez as smooth as humanly possible. Nobody wants extra stress when they're already dealing with health stuff, right? Here are some insider tips to help you navigate the hospital like a pro. First things first: Preparation is key. Before you even leave the house, gather all your important documents. We're talking about your ID, insurance card, a list of your current medications (including dosages), and any referral letters or medical records you might have. Having these ready will save you time and hassle at check-in. Next up, timing matters. If you have a scheduled appointment, aim to arrive at least 15-20 minutes early. This gives you a buffer for parking, finding the right department, and completing any necessary paperwork. Plus, it shows respect for the healthcare providers' time. Communication is crucial. When you're talking to doctors and nurses, be clear and concise about your symptoms, concerns, and questions. Don't be afraid to speak up if you don't understand something. They're there to help, and they can only do that if you're open and honest. Bring a support person if you can. Having a friend or family member with you can provide emotional support and help you remember important information. They can also advocate for you if you're feeling overwhelmed. Take notes during your appointment. Jot down key points, instructions, and any follow-up steps you need to take. This will help you remember everything later and avoid confusion. Understand your insurance coverage. Before your visit, check with your insurance company to see what's covered and what your out-of-pocket costs might be. This will help you avoid unexpected bills down the road. Pack a comfort kit. Bring a few items that will make your wait more comfortable, such as a book, a magazine, a phone charger, and a snack. You never know how long you might be waiting, so it's good to be prepared. Be patient and understanding. Hospital staff are often working under pressure, and delays can happen. Try to be patient and understanding, and treat them with respect. A little kindness can go a long way. Follow up after your visit. If you have any questions or concerns after you leave the hospital, don't hesitate to call. It's better to get clarification than to worry about something. Finally, remember to take care of yourself. Getting enough rest, eating healthy, and staying hydrated can all help you recover faster and feel better overall.     First Medical Mayaguez: Contact and Location

    Alright, let's get down to the practical stuff: how to actually get in touch with First Medical Mayaguez and where to find it. Knowing this info can save you a lot of stress when you need it most. First off, the address. You can find First Medical Mayaguez at Carr 68 Numero 555 Bo. Guanajibo, Mayaguez, Puerto Rico 00680. If you're using a GPS or a map app, punch that in, and you should be good to go. As for phone numbers, it's always a good idea to have a couple of options handy. The main number for the hospital is +1 787-268-8080. Keep this number in your phone or written down somewhere easily accessible. It's also a good idea to check their official website for any additional contact numbers or specific department lines. The website can also provide valuable information about visiting hours, specific services, and any updates or announcements. You might find answers to your questions there without even needing to call. If you need to send any documents or correspondence, make sure you have the correct mailing address. Using the address mentioned above should ensure your mail gets to the right place. For emergencies, remember that the emergency department is open 24/7.
